Output 9880968ebbc74bdfad14c79e3123270397e1bc5a2e6d8a8065e0400c28cb0e6d:1

value
5610487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a7c3b4fe8bf1629fe71d227e771af570538735 OP_EQUAL
address
3DWa4mdfJLiotFJocerUyiUChEvBv6fEHZ
transaction
9880968ebbc74bdfad14c79e3123270397e1bc5a2e6d8a8065e0400c28cb0e6d